About Us

UnternehmerTUM is Europe's leading center for innovation and entrepreneurship – and we are currently building the technological foundation for how an entire organization can use AI productively, securely, and effectively. As an AI Architect, you will shape this foundation: from the fundamental stack decision to the reference implementation that other teams can use as a model. You will make architectural decisions with far-reaching consequences for the entire company – and remain actively involved in coding the system yourself.

Your tasks

With us, you make architectural decisions with real impact: You work at the interface between AI responsibility, specialist departments, IT and the Trusted AI Board – and remain hands-on in the implementation, instead of just drawing up concepts.


  • Setting AI architecture & stack decisions (30%): You define company-wide principles, make fundamental stack decisions, and establish patterns that other teams can reuse.
  • Evaluate & further develop the tech approach (15%): You critically examine our current approach and decide, with justification, whether it should be confirmed, refined or replaced – including the migration path.
  • Design central AI platform (25%): You will build the integration and gateway architecture as well as a provider-neutral model policy on which the entire company is based.
  • Setting the security and data access baseline (15%): You will develop security standards together with data owners and the CISO and represent the architectural decisions in the Trusted AI Board.
  • Providing guidance to the organization (15%): You provide templates and reference implementations and guide teams through architecture reviews and office hours.

Your profile

  • 7+ years of experience in production software, including several years as an architect or tech lead
  • 2+ years of experience with LLM/RAG systems in production environments
  • Experience with integration architecture in heterogeneous SaaS landscapes (API gateways, authentication, data access)
  • Confident handling of agent-based tooling, e.g., Claude Code or similar tools
  • Fluent English (at least B2 level)
  • Enjoyment in enforcing standards in an established, decentralized organization through persuasion rather than instruction.
  • Ideally, you also have a deep understanding of retrieval architectures, agent orchestration, and evaluation-driven development, and experience in convincing both engineering teams and management of architectural decisions.
